Academic Overview

John Wood Community College is a public, 2-4 years institute located in Quincy, Illinois. It is an Associate's - Public Suburban-serving Single Campus by Carnegie Classification and its highest degree is Associate's degree.
The 2024 tuition & fees is $9,000 for undergraduate students. The school offers only undergraduate programs and a total of 1,718 students are enrolled.
The salary after graduation from John Wood Community College varies by major programs where the average earning after 10 years is $32,600. You can check the average salary by the major programs on the area of study page.

Key Academic Statistics

The following chart illustrates the 2024 key academic statistics at John Wood CC.
The average received amount of financial aid is $5,416 and 71% of undergraduate students received grants or scholarship aid. A total of 1,718 students is attending , and the student to faculty ratio is 12 to 1.

Special Learning Opportunities

John Wood Community College offers online education (distance learning opportunities) for undergraduate programs. It offers weekend/evening classes which is a program that allows students to take a complete course of study and attend classes only on weekends or only in evenings.
